Abstract

We study two subgroups of the Picard group Pic(R-gr) of a category of graded modules: the subgroup gr-Pic(R#PG) of classes of graded equivalences and the subgroup Pic(R#PG)G of classes of equivalences which commute with the suspensions in Pic(R-gr). We prove that in general these groups are not the same and show that they are related by an exact sequence of cohomology. © 1999 Elsevier Science B.V. All rights reserved.
